Aryans Club ties up with Techno India dmanewsdesk July 12, 2008
Kolkata,Aryans Club ties up with Techno India, one of the oldest in the country, Friday announced a tie-up with leading knowledge management group Techno India for the upcoming soccer season.

The 126-year-old club, now languishing in the first division A group of the Kolkata Football League, also appointed Bengali film hero Chiranjeet as its brand ambassador at a function here.

Chiranjeet said, "We will all work together to revive Aryans' lost glory. We will ensure that it is promoted to the glamorous premier division."

"Aryan is a temple and its players are like priests. I'm sure the club will return to the big league," he said.

P.K. Banerjee, Goutam Sarkar, Prasun Banerjee, Sudhir Karmakar, Shivaji Banerjee, Biswajit Bhattacharya, and Sisir Ghosh - who started their soccer career in Aryans - were present on the occasion.
